A dying star that has collapsed to the size of earth and is slowly cooling off. Located at the lower left of the H-R diagram
White dwarfs
What causes a star to shine bright?
Nuclear fusion happening in their core
What are the 5 steps to a stars formation?
The central part of the nebula is denser (meaning has more stuff) which traps radiation creating a hot central bulge called a protostar
A protostar gathers more mass around itself to create a huge burning ball of gas
When the center reaches 10 million K, hydrogen fuse together to make helium nuclei
Starting this nuclear fuel marks the change from protostar to star
When the nuclear fusion becomes fast enough, the pull of more mass stops and size of the star remains stable
